Egypt - Pulses Yield

Since 2014, Egypt Pulses Yield grew 4.8%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 6 among other countries in Pulses Yield with 38,899 Hectograms Per Hectare. Egypt is overtaken by Uzbekistan, which was ranked number 5 with 39,163 Hectograms Per Hectare and is followed by Denmark with 38,198 Hectograms Per Hectare. Ireland topped the ranking with 49,951 Hectograms Per Hectare in 2019, that is an increase of 97.9% versus 2018. Jordan, Belgium and Netherlands resp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Jordan witnessed the best average annual growth at +75% per year, while Botswana recorded the worst performance at -11.7% per year.
